Intel's ambition: processor enters base station to expand wireless business

Intel is currently carrying out an ambitious plan in its Beijing laboratory: the company is looking for the possibility of replacing the DSP (Digital Signal Processors) processor in 3G / 4G base stations with a general-purpose CPU.

In recent years, Intel ’s interest in embedded system SoCs has gradually increased, including a wide range from smart phones to communication base stations. According to Zhang Yimin, head of the Intel Embedded Application Lab, most of the research work is carried out in a laboratory in Beijing.

Intel is gradually increasing its R & D capabilities in China. There are now more than 100 researchers (accounting for about 10% of Intel ’s total R & D capabilities) working in a laboratory in Beijing. One of the main reasons for increasing the manpower of China's R & D department is that Mainland China is the world's most suitable market for expanding new businesses.

For example, if Intel ’s processor development process requires a base station with a coverage of 100,000 users, it is likely to be the entire population of a small city in North America or Europe, and the coverage of 100,000 in China may only need to be in a certain area. Each university city can start new communication technology testing.

According to industry rumors, Intel will cooperate with Chinese industry giant Huawei to enter the communications infrastructure market. Here is another reason why Intel ’s R & D power turns to China: At present, the Chinese government is advancing the triple-play process. Once a huge communication network with nearly 1 billion users will be formed, it will require a large number of network equipment; Intel is very important Because of this, the investment in the embedded sector is increased year by year.

At the same time, in addition to the base station, Intel will also work on mobile applications including software and hardware. Although the current power consumption of the company's Atom processor is still much higher than the current SoC products in smart phones, it will be made fully in the next 22nm process next year. After the introduction, Intel is expected to develop a processor suitable for smartphone applications.

Although there are many rumors, Intel has not officially announced the abandonment of the MeeGo operating system. However, in the face of strong opponents such as iOS, it is expected that Intel will eventually invest in the arms of open source camps such as Android or old friends Microsoft.
